carnival柯林斯释义

N-COUNT狂欢节;嘉年华会

A carnival is a public festival during which people play music and sometimes dance in the streets.

    N-COUNT流动游乐场;嘉年华

    A carnival is a travelling show which is held in a park or field and at which there are machines to ride on, entertainments, and games.

      N-COUNT激动人心的事物的组合;五彩斑斓;八音齐奏

      A carnival of something such as colours or sounds is a bright or exciting mixture of them.

      • The avenues lined with jacaranda trees burst into a carnival of purple.

        大街的两旁种着蓝花楹,绽放的花朵汇成一片紫色的海洋。

      carnival英文释义

      Noun

      1. a festival marked by merrymaking and processions

        2. a frenetic disorganized (and often comic) disturbance suggestive of a circus or carnival;

        • it was so funny it was a circus
        • the whole occasion had a carnival atmosphere

        3. a traveling show; having sideshows and rides and games of skill etc.
